In this episode of Deck Builders Akron OH, we help you sort through common deck railing materials with a focus on strength, safety, and upkeep. Railing is not just a design choice; it’s a key safety feature on decks, porches, and stairs. Tuff Deck Builders Akron OH explains how wood, composite, aluminum, and mixed systems compare in terms of durability, maintenance needs, and long‑term performance in outdoor living spaces.
We start with wood railings, a classic choice that many homeowners know well. You’ll hear how wood can be shaped and finished to match decks, patios, and porches, but also why it needs regular sealing or painting to handle weather. We then move to composite railing systems, which pair well with composite decking and offer a cleaner look with lower ongoing maintenance. We explain how these systems are built, how they handle sun and moisture, and what to expect over time.
Aluminum railings come next, bringing strength with slim profiles that keep views open. We talk about how aluminum stands up to weather, how it pairs with both wood and composite decks, and why it’s often a good option when you want a railing you don’t have to think about very often. We also touch on mixed systems that combine metal balusters with wood or composite rails, giving you a blend of traditional and modern qualities.
If you’re planning a new deck, replacing an older one, or updating railings as part of a backyard renovation, this episode will help you pick a railing material that fits your goals for safety and low maintenance. We keep the focus on facts and practical trade‑offs.
